Abstract
The invention discloses a method for cultivating dry-planted rice seeds, which comprises a layout method of rice planting areas and a cross breeding method. According to the invention, the layout and area ratio of the rice dry-field planting area and the rice paddy-field planting area are skillfully and reasonably designed, pollination and pollination are carried out by utilizing natural conditions, rice hybridization is realized, rice seeds which can be directly sowed in the dry field are obtained, the requirement of the rice planting on water is greatly reduced, the irrigation cost is reduced, meanwhile, the rice seeds obtained by the method can be directly sowed in the dry field, the steps of rice planting are simplified, and manpower and material resources are saved. The method is simple, low in cost and easy to widely spread and apply.

Background
The rice is one of the main grain crops in China and plays an important role in grain production, so that the rice yield is increased, the rice planting area is enlarged, and the rice is very important for ensuring the grain safety. At present, the main planting mode of rice in China is mainly paddy field planting, the planting conditions are complex, the requirement is high, and the planting and the yield of the rice are affected. Especially in the north, due to the limitation of natural conditions, the rice planting has large demand for moisture, higher irrigation cost and difficult management.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ention aims to provide a cultivation method of dry-land rice seeds, and the rice seeds which can be directly sown in dry lands can be produced by hybridization, so that the requirement of rice planting is reduced, the rice planting cost is saved, and the rice yield is improved.
In order to realize the purpose, the following technical scheme is provided:
a method for cultivating dry-planting rice seeds comprises a layout method of rice planting areas and a cross breeding method:
the layout method of the rice planting area is a method for surrounding a dry land by a paddy field, and comprises the following steps:
s1: selecting a farmland, weeding, renovating, adding a soil conditioner into the farmland, and removing residual fertilizer and pesticide in the farmland to serve as a rice planting area;
s2: dividing a planting area into two areas, including a dry farmland area and a paddy field area, wherein the dry farmland area is positioned in the center of the whole planting area, the paddy field area surrounds the dry farmland area, is distributed around the dry farmland area and is separated from the dry farmland area through a ridge, and the area ratio of the dry farmland area to the paddy field area is 1: 1;
s3: and irrigating and storing water in the paddy field area to make the water surface 5-10 cm higher than the planting area, and not irrigating in the dry field area.
The cross breeding method comprises the following steps:
a: pretreating a seedling raising field: weeding the seedling raising field, moistening soil after 2-3 days, and then renovating to ensure that the humidity of the soil is between 6% and 10%;
b: seedling culture: selecting full-grain rice seeds, sowing the rice seeds in a seedling raising field every 5cm, constructing a greenhouse in the seedling raising field after sowing, and removing the greenhouse after 35-40 days;
c: field management before seedling transplanting: draining the paddy field area 1-2 days before transplanting seedlings, and controlling the height of the water surface to be 1-3 cm;
d: transplanting seedlings: selecting rice seedlings with good growth vigor, and transplanting the rice seedlings to a planting area according to the distance of one rice seedling per 5 centimeters;
e: field management during growth: keeping the water flow circulation of the paddy field area and controlling the water surface to submerge the seedling roots by 2cm-5 cm; properly irrigating the dry farmland to ensure that the moisture content of the dry farmland is between 40 and 45 percent;
f: fertilizing: fertilizing the planting area 8-9 days after the seedlings are transplanted, and weeding in the rice growing process;
g: pollination and hybridization: in the heading and flowering period of rice, the wind and insects are used for pollen transmission, so that the rice is naturally pollinated and hybridized;
h: harvesting: when the rice ears of the hybridized rice are drooping and golden and full, the rice in the dry land area and the rice in the paddy field area can be respectively harvested, and seeds are respectively collected and stored;
i: seed selection: selecting rice seeds harvested in dry farmland, namely dry-planted rice seeds.
Preferably, the dry farmland area is surrounded by the paddy field, so that the moisture content is sufficient, and the moisture requirement can be met only by proper irrigation.
